"Description:
Approximately in the center of the courtyard the well shaft from around 1362 created by the resigned Archbishop Boemund II."

This monumental old well is about 10 meters deep. It is dry and you can see at the bottom of the well a good number of coins that tourists throw down.

The opening has 2 metal grates as security, one on top and one inside.
